Call To Schedule An Appointment Or House Call
Long-term care planning is something you may need to do for your…
If you are responsible for your loved one’s estate, you could have…
Death is a subject most people prefer to avoid thinking or talking…
487 Adams Street Milton, MA 02186
1324 Belmont Street Suite 101A Brockton, MA 02301
1000 Plain Street Marshfield, MA 02051
33 Great Neck Road South Mashpee, MA 02649